介绍
PyAutoGUI是一个图形用户界面自动化工具,通过屏幕x,y坐标系统获得目标位置,控制模拟鼠标和键盘进行点击、发送等功能,从而达到自动化测试目的。
使用说明
鼠标操作
使用PyautoGUI模块可以模拟鼠标进行点击操作,如单、双击,左击右击,鼠标移动。
鼠标点击
pyautogui.click() #点击当前位置
pyautogui.leftClick() #左击
pyautogui.rightClick() #右击
pyautogui.middleClick #中间滚轮单击
获取鼠标位置
pyautogui.position() #获取鼠标当前位置
获取屏幕分辨率
pyautogui.size() #获取当前屏幕分辨率
鼠标移动
pyautuogui.moveTo(x,y,duration=time) #x,y为坐标点,duration代表以移动时长
鼠标拖动
pyautogui.dragTo(x,y,button='left')#left往左拖动,right往右拖动
鼠标滚动